From d9d955db203dd068efcb5407e0a02e16aa307879 Mon Sep 17 00:00:00 2001 From: Sumanth Krishna Date: Fri, 21 Jan 2011 22:04:24 +0530 Subject: [PATCH] slider disabled state is enabled in _theme_hook() --- src/lib/elm_slider.c |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/lib/elm_slider.c b/src/lib/elm_slider.c index fb8a01d..43b2494 100644 --- a/src/lib/elm_slider.c +++ b/src/lib/elm_slider.c @@ -197,6 +197,10 @@ _theme_hook(Evas_Object *obj) _elm_theme_object_set(obj, wd->slider, "slider", "horizontal", elm_widget_style_get(obj)); else _elm_theme_object_set(obj, wd->slider, "slider", "vertical", elm_widget_style_get(obj)); + if (elm_widget_disabled_get(data)) + edje_object_signal_emit(wd->slider, "elm,state,disabled", "elm"); + else + edje_object_signal_emit(wd->slider, "elm,state,enabled", "elm"); if (wd->icon) { edje_object_part_swallow(wd->slider, "elm.swallow.content", wd->icon); -- 2.7.4